MyTech Group Bhd (7692) has a Net Asset Quality Index of 96.6% as of December 2025. This metric measures the proportion of total assets financed by shareholders' equity — total assets of RM55.59 Million minus total liabilities of RM1.89 Million yields net assets of RM53.70 Million. A higher index indicates a stronger, lower-leverage balance sheet. Check 7692 cash and liquid asset ratio to evaluate the company's liquid asset resilience ratio.
